    Okafor was dominant on the glass with 14 rebounds and 13 points; however, I had to go with Winslow and his 23 points, 10 rebounds performance. Uncharacteristically, we had poor guard play tonight, Tyus Jones with six turnovers and Cook 1-8 on 3-pointers.

    Stat line: 40 minutes, 23 points, 9 rebounds, 1 assist, 2 steals, 3 blocks, 2 turnovers, 10-16 FG, 3-5 3PT FG, 0-1 FT.

    Every Duke player committed at least one turnover. Tyus had 6.
